There are two types of plates: continental and oceanic. Oceanic plates are made of mafic or basaltic rock. Continental plates are made of felsic or granitic rock. The main features of subduction zones include ocean trenches, volcanoes, and mountains. Other features include accretionary wedges, forearc basins, backarc basins and remnant arcs.

6. The Cascade Volcanoes were formed by the subduction of the Juan de Fuca, Explorer and the Gorda Plate (remnants of the much larger Farallon Plate) under the North American Plate along the Cascadia subduction zone.
